Andrew VK3BFA wrote:
I want to turn up a round perspex piece to fit in a circular hole in
the front panel of a radio I am building. I start with a piece of
perspex 4 inches square, and turn in down to the required fit.


I did this to make some inspection hole covers for my neighbour's
homebuilt aircraft. BTW, Perspex = Lucite = Acrylic
Cut out approximately square piece of Perspex a little larger than the
required disk from sheet. Drill 4 holes near the corners.
Secure this to a square piece of wood (e.g. 3/4" ply) with four small
wood screws.
Mount in four jaw chuck.
Press firmly on the center with a live center. A bit of old inner tube
will prevent scratching.
Use a pointy, sharp bit to cut your circle at SLOW speed.

A few strokes with a file or abrasive paper will clean up the sharp edges.
